As we all know, MySQL is one of the most widely used database management systems in the world. It is a powerful and flexible system that can be used for a variety of purposes, such as storing and organizing data, managing website content, and creating reports. In this article, we’ll show you how to create reports in Excel using MySQL, including how to create multiple tables and import data into Excel.
Creating a Report in Excel Using MySQL
To begin creating a report in Excel using MySQL, you will first need to have a MySQL database set up. If you are not familiar with MySQL, you can download it for free from the official website. Once you have MySQL installed, you can begin creating your report in Excel:
Importing Data into Excel
The first step in creating a report in Excel using MySQL is to import data from your MySQL database into Excel. Excel makes this process very easy through the use of its “From Database” feature. Here’s how to do it:
- Open Microsoft Excel on your computer and click on the “Data” tab in the Ribbon at the top of the screen.
- Click on the “From Database” icon to open the “From Database” window.
- Select “From MySQL Database” and click “Next.”
- Enter your MySQL server name and password, and select the appropriate database from the drop-down list.
- Select the tables that you want to import into Excel and click “Finish.”
- Now, Excel will automatically import the data from your MySQL database into Excel. You can manipulate the data as you wish, including sorting, filtering, and formatting it as you like. You now have the raw data needed to create your report.
Creating Multiple Tables in Excel
Excel allows you to create multiple tables in a single workbook, which is useful if you need to compare and contrast data from different sources or different tables in the same database. Here’s how to create multiple tables in Excel:
- Open Excel and create a new workbook.
- Click on the “Insert” tab in the Ribbon at the top of the screen.
- Click on the “Table” icon to insert a new table.
- With the table selected, go to the “Table Tools” tab in the Ribbon and click on “Design.”
- Choose your desired style for the table.
- Enter your data into the table.
- If you want to create another table, simply repeat the steps above.
FAQ
Q: Can I automate the report creation process?
A: Yes, you can automate the report creation process using VBA macros. VBA is a powerful programming language that allows you to automate many functions in Excel. You can record macros while performing the tasks manually, such as importing data, formatting, and creating charts, and then play back the macros to automate the entire process.
Q: How do I create a chart in Excel using MySQL data?
A: Creating a chart in Excel using MySQL data is very easy. After importing the data into Excel, you can simply select the data and use the “Insert Chart” function to create a chart. From there, you can customize the chart as needed, such as by changing the chart type or adding labels and titles.
Conclusion
Creating a report in Excel using MySQL can be a very useful and powerful tool for managing and analyzing data. Excel makes it easy to import data from MySQL, create multiple tables, and even automate the reporting process with macros. With a little bit of practice and knowledge of Excel, you can create informative and visually appealing reports that can help you make better decisions and manage your business more effectively.
Video Tutorial
For those who prefer visual learning, here’s a video tutorial on how to create a report in Excel using MySQL: